Wall Water Damage Repair Cost In Danville, GA

The cost of Wall Water Damage Repair in Danville, GA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on typical prices for the services listed below. Typical price ranges service costs and local conditions are just a few factors that influence the final cost.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Moisture Detection and Assessment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Equipment Rental and Labor $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
